1992 was a good year.  Everyone tried to do the right thing, but the forces of passive aggressive opposition were over-whelming.  Within the military, only the U.S. Marine Corps took this seriiously, and within the U.S. Intelligence Community (more like an archipelago) only the Defense Intelligence Agency–and within that agency only one man, Paul Wallner, took this seriously.  Everywhere we went, “nice to have, not invented here, certainly not interested in redirecting funds” was the refrain.  Below is a decent effort by decent people.
